The Sales Representative, Consumer and Individual is responsible for promoting new sales and retention of Delta Dental of Idahos individual dental benefits. As an individual contributor, the Sales Representative will receive and follow up on direct consumer inquiries and selling opportunities for individual product sales, as well as provide support and book of business management-related assistance to brokers.

To be successful in this role, you must demonstrate a high level of professionalism in all business communications that represent Delta Dental to the public. Excellent interpersonal skills to develop and maintain successful working relationships are key to this position. Ideal candidates will be competitive, motivated, collaborative, and have exceptional relationship-building skills.

Essential Functions

  • Respond to and fulfill opportunities for direct individual sales and retention.
  • Respond to Inside Sales calls with the objective of selling Individual policies directly to consumers and offering recommendations based on analysis of their insurance needs.
  • Manage existing Individual business relationships, supporting brokers and direct consumer requests that are not traditionally served by customer service or eligibility teams.
  • Update and educate consumers and producers selling our products. Convey differentiated value and network strength using marketing materials to promote the company and its focus on improving oral health and wellness.
  • Maintain detailed knowledge of new and existing DDID and competitor individual products, including industry information, new product information, legislative changes, coverages, and technology.
  • Provide timely and accurate notes in the sales tracking system regarding interactions with our producers as well as consultation, education of products, and associated services.
  • Collaborate with the Sales Representative II to receive, facilitate and manage individual product solutions for recently termed group policies by sending sales materials, answering questions, and coordinating the transition to an individual product solution.
  • Gather and report competitive information and sales activities.
  • Monitor and respond to termination requests.
  • Demonstrate a commitment to the organizations core values, code of ethics, and compliance/security standards.
  • Other duties as assigned.

Requirements

KNOWLEDGE, SKILLS, AND ABILITIES

  • High School Diploma or equivalent required. Some college preferred. Experience in health or dental insurance industry preferred.
  • Must possess or obtain an Idaho producer license in Health & Disability through the state insurance exam within 30 days of employment.
  • Strong proficiency with Microsoft Word, Outlook, PowerPoint, and Excel and ability to learn and become a subject matter expert on additional software systems.
  • Maintain a valid drivers license and a good driving record.
  • Ability to travel on a limited, as-needed basis.
  • Strong skills related to motivation, initiative, and collaboration.
  • Strong, professional written and verbal communication skills as well as the ability to explain complicated technical issues.
  • Ability to work independently or as part of a team.
  • Demonstrate excellent problem-solving and organization skills.
